Understanding the MT1887 Driver: Purpose, Troubleshooting, and Installation

The is a vital software component that enables your operating system to communicate with external optical disc drives powered by the MediaTek MT1887 chipset . This specific chipset is a highly integrated single-chip processor designed for external, rewritable CD and DVD drives—such as the popular Samsung SE-208 external DVD writer . It manages CD/DVD decoding, encoding, and high-speed data transmission over a USB 2.0 interface.

When you plug in a Samsung SE-208 or similar external DVD writer, your operating system's hardware manager uses its unique Vendor and Product IDs (e.g., 0e8d:1806 , with 0e8d belonging to MediaTek Inc. and 1806 representing this specific product) to query its local driver database. It expects to find a device named something like "TSSTcorp CDDVDW SE-218GN", but behind the scenes, it’s a "MediaTek MT1887" chipset. The is a highly integrated single-chip platform designed specifically for external rewritable DVD drives . Unlike many older external drives that use a SATA-to-USB bridge converter, the MT1887 handles both the optical disc controller and the USB 2.0 interface directly on the same chip, making it a common heart for modern slim portable DVD writers.
